MikroTik is a privately owned company headquartered in Latvia. Founded in 1996, it employs approximately 610 individuals and its main product is Information Services. The company specializes in developing routers and wireless ISP systems, providing hardware and software for Internet connectivity around the world.
On February 18, 2026, a review highlighted the MikroTik CRS418-8P-8G-2S+RM, a 16-port 1GbE switch with two SFP+ 10G ports, which integrates a Qualcomm Arm-CPU with a Marvell Prestera switch chip and includes PoE+ functionality. Earlier, on January 16, 2026, MikroTik announced its CRS804 DDQ, a 4-port 400GbE switch, establishing it as the company's second offering in the 400GbE switch segment. This follows MikroTik's introduction of the hAP be3 Media on December 21, 2025, which marked its first router supporting the WiFi 7 standard.
